Has someone soft-blocked you? Maybe someone’s made subtweets about you, told others in your class things about you, or tagged bad photos of you and refused to take them down. These things are hard and mean. The ultimate form of harm online comes from sextortion. Sextortion is what happens when someone takes photos or videos of or from you and then threatens to release those pics and vids. 1 Cited from the 2023-2024 Thorn Youth Perspectives Survey.
